





โป๏ธ Brew Bold, Live Green: Coffee Filters That Care
If You Care Coffee Filters No 2 are made from FSC certified, unbleached, chlorine-free paper that ensures a pure coffee taste without plastic contamination. Featuring strong seams that resist breaking, these filters are certified compostable for both home and industrial composting. Packaged in FSC certified recycled board, they offer an eco-conscious choice for drip coffee lovers seeking durability and sustainability in every brew.

Easy to Use, Easy to Dispose, Better for the Environment
I NEED coffee in my life and I have a drip machine so filters are a must, but I want something that doesn't have plastics in and isn't environmentally harmful. Enter these filters. They stay strong, even when just used. They are easily popped into the machine, fit perfectly, filter the coffee beautifully if you don't like a ton of sediment (some like standing a spoon in their coffee but I'm less keen), and after use, I can pop the whole thing straight in the food waste or compost with no mess or fuss. Afterwards, I leave the filter section out to dry naturally. For 100 of these filter papers, it's a bargain and I wouldn't be without them.

Great coffee with the bonus of doing your bit for the environment
I was looking to purchase unbleached Coffee filters for my V60 Dripper as I wanted to do my bit for the environment. Unbleached filters don't necessarily brew a better cup of coffee but they are more environmentally friendly and less processed than bleached filters as is evidenced by their natural brown color. The filters are made from responsibly sourced paper and the box they come in is made from recycled paper. I found the quality of the filters to be fine with no noticeable difference in the taste of the brewed coffee. The filters appear well made as well i.e. no defects or coming apart. I just place the used filters and coffee grains on the compost heap for the worms to do their stuff. So overall a great buy and I will definitely purchase them again.

Good filters that do the job
I've been using these filters daily for the last 2 months and these filters have worked every time without issue. No splits or problems to report (I do wonder if reviewers who report splits are folding the seams, which needs doing with all these types of filter). Always happy to buy products that have 'green' credentials and have no plastic. The fact that the box doubles as a dispenser is actually very convenient. Summary: I'll be buying this product again
